there are a lot of duplicates or similar bug reports, so i don’t know
which one was the one, i was encountering.

also i had problems with my graphics card and installed and uninstalled
a lot of packages. nevertheless:

my ttys were broken with weird random noisy color, but were still
responsive (entering username and password, then emitting sounds, or
touching files)—both with proprietary nvidia driveres and open source nv
drivers.

i don't know why, but sometime in the process i typed grub --version in
a terminal, which printed grub 0.97something to the terminal. i was
confused, since i thought karmic upgraded to grub2 and i already
executed the necessary commands to upgrade my old grub installation to
the new one. all files in /boot/grub were there with old grub, so i
thought it was grub2. but those files were never be used.

after installing grub2 (sudo apt-get install grub-pc) all my ttys work
again now. with nv as well as with nvidia. hope this hopes people with
similar bugs
